Our #TechLitigation Thursday starts today!
🤖 automated fraud detection
⚖️ Rb. Amsterdam - C/13/696010 / HA ZA 21-81
Uber drivers challenged the company's decision to deactivate their accounts on the basis of alleged fraudulent acts

Article 3 of the #ECHR enjoins to States to ensure that detainees be held in conditions which are compatible with respect for #humanrights and for their #humandignity.
Read our @COE_Execution thematic factsheet on conditions of #detention to know more.
